要在PostgreSQL中安装PostGIS扩展,你可以按照以下步骤操作: 确保PostgreSQL数据库已经正确安装并运行: 你可以通过运行psql -V来检查PostgreSQL是否已安装并查看其版本。 使用psql或其他PostgreSQL客户端登录到数据库: 如果你使用的是命令行,可以使用psql -U your_username -d your_database登录到你的PostgreSQL数据库。
PostGIS 是一个开源数据库拓展,它为 PostgreSQL 数据库增加了对地理空间数据的支持。PostGIS 使得空间数据的存储、查询和分析变得简单高效。PostGIS 是 Postgresql 的一个插件,本文将介绍 Unbuntu 平台下如何安装 PostGIS 拓展的一些步骤和注意的问题。在安装 PostGIS 前应该先安装好 Postgresql。
PostGIS 3.5 HTML:enjafrzh_Hansdeko_KResitbr PostGIS 3.5 PDF:enjafrzh_Hansdeko_KResitbr PostGIS 3.5 备忘单: postgis:enjafrzh_Hansdeko_KResitbr 光栅:enjafrzh_Hansdeko_KResitbr sfcgal:enjafrzh_Hansdeko_KResitbr 拓扑:enjafrzh_Hansdeko_KResitbr Tiger_geocoder:enjafrzh_Hansdeko_KResitbr 提示和...
CREATE EXTENSION postgis:启用PostGIS扩展。 测试PostGIS安装 使用以下命令来测试PostGIS是否安装成功: SELECTPostGIS_version(); 1. 如果成功安装,将会显示PostGIS的版本信息。 类图 Docker+pullImage(imageName)+createContainer(containerName, imageName, options)+execCommand(containerName, command)PostGIS+installP...
CREATE EXTENSION postgis; 以上步骤完成后,你的Postgresql数据库就已经成功添加了PostGIS插件,现在你可以开始存储和查询地理空间数据了。 三、使用PostGIS进行空间查询 PostGIS提供了丰富的空间函数和操作符,使得在数据库中进行空间查询变得简单高效。以下是一个简单的示例,演示如何使用PostGIS查询某个区域内的所有点: ...
例子:PostGIS 详情页 我想,用户吭哧吭哧抱怨扩展编译失败的问题,应该能在这里得到最终的解决。 当然题外话是广告时间,安装这些扩展,使用这个仓库的最简单的方式是什么?当然是开箱即用的 PostgreSQL 数据库发行版 ——Pigsty——但这并非必选项。 你依然可以用简单的一行 shell 在任何 EL/Debian/Ubuntu 系统上启用此仓...
postgresql安装postgis扩展模块 为postgresql安装postgis扩展模块: 1、安装postgis 2、在指定数据库下执行下面语句 CREATE EXTENSION postgis 3、验证:执行下面语句不报错即可 SELECT ST_SetSRID(ST_Point(-87.71,43.741),4326),ST_GeomFromText('POINT(-87.71 43.741)',4326)...
使用PostgreSQL 的CREATE EXTENSION命令来安装 PostGIS 扩展。打开终端或命令行工具,连接到 PostgreSQL 数据库: psql-U your_username-d your_database 然后执行以下 SQL 命令: CREATE EXTENSION postgis; 验证安装: 安装完成后,可以通过查询pg_extension表来验证 PostGIS 是否已成功安装: ...
一些常见的PostgreSQL extension类型包括: PostGIS:用于地理信息系统的空间数据管理和查询的扩展。 pgcrypto:用于加密和解密数据的扩展。 hstore:用于存储和操作键值对数据的扩展。 citext:用于大小写不敏感的文本比较和存储的扩展。 pg_trgm:用于模糊文本匹配和相似度计算的扩展。 pg_stat_statements:用于跟踪SQL查询性能...
在执行create extension postgis;命令后 提示错误 ERROR: permission denied to create extension "postgis" --权限不够 HINT: Must be superuser to create this extension. -- 只有超级用户能创建扩展 2 解决方法 2.1 解决方法1 直接使用postgres_sys用户连接数据库即可 2.2 解决方法2 用postgres_sys修改连接账户...